The Biblical baby name Iscariot is Hebrew in origin and it's meaning is man of Kerioth.
Iscariot is pronounced is-kar-ee-o'-t. Iscariot is the surname of Judas, the apostle who betrayed Jesus. Biblical reference for baby name Iscariot: Matthew 10:4; 26:14; Mark 3:19; 14:10; Luke 6:16; 22:3; John 6:71; 12:4; 13:2, 26; 14:22 Strong's Bible concordance G2469 |
